## Changelog — GiftNote Mailer v4.2.0

Defaults changed. Receipt PDFs now signed by default; unsigned mode requires explicit opt-out. TLS 1.2 minimum enforced on SMTP relay. Retry window cut from 24h to 6h to limit replay exposure. Attachment size cap lowered to 2 MB. Donor-name redaction in logs is now on by default. Bounce webhooks require HMAC verification. No migration needed; overrides in existing deployments are preserved. For audit, the effective default configuration after this release is as follows.

config for kagup-hahig:
druwyn:
  pin: 2801
  metrics_host: metrics.druwyn.zemvarlabs.internal
  tenant: sorius
  seal: seal_798a43d7

Reseller Programme — Managers Only

The Corvane Partner Network relaunches next quarter. Key points: tiering moves from revenue-based to certification-based; rebates paid quarterly; non-performing partners exit after two review cycles. Branch managers own local recruitment targets and must log pipeline weekly. Do not share terms externally before launch. The confidential commercial intent is recorded immediately below.

management briefing: Jorixax Holdings is in early talks to buy Casixax Holdings for about $420.3 million. The Fenmir launch date is October 27, and nothing goes to the press before then. Legal wants the Keloxek Foods term sheet redrafted before April 16.

## CI note: retiring the homegrown job queue

We replaced the old Pellgrove queue (in-house, Redis-backed, no retries) with the managed Quillrun scheduler. Workers now pull from Quillrun topics; the legacy daemon is disabled but not deleted until next quarter. If jobs stall, check topic lag before blaming workers. All migrated pipelines stamp their runs with the trace token below.

trace token, kahog-tajeg: htk6_97d963

## Account Recovery — Trailnote Offline Mode

When a surveyor's Trailnote app has been offline for 30+ days, their local credentials expire and sync refuses to resume. Don't make them wipe the device — all their unsynced field data lives there! Instead, open the support console, pick "Offline Reinstate," and enter their handle. The console will ask for the support team's shared recovery passphrase before issuing a reinstatement token. Use the one below.

unlock words, bagaf-fajeg: zorael-kelax-fraath-quenix-eliok-sileth-aldmir-wenir-druiel